Armonk Tennis Camp
  The Tennis Program is individually designed to methodically challenge players of all levels and ages, 6 - 15. Throughout the week, campers will be encouraged to enhance their strokes and strategies via group lessons, skill building drills, organized play, individual attention, video sessions, target training, fitness routines and more.  All campers are carefully grouped by the tennis director based on skill level and age. Each camper will be thoroughly evaluated during the week and a detailed progress report will be sent home at week's end.

Beginners and Advanced Beginners - The emphasis will be on fundamental stroke production and consistency. Campers will learn the correct mechanics of each stroke, proper court position and movement, and sound strategies for future growth and development.  All of the basic techniques will be constantly reinforced through fun games, singles and doubles play, coordination exercises, and team competitions.

Intermediate and Advanced Players - Routines are specifically designed to improve and strengthen strokes to produce more reliable and effective results. Repetitions are practiced to build total self confidence and muscle memory.  Physical and mental toughness will be combined with advanced strategies for singles and doubles point play and match play.

High School and Tournament Players will work on physical conditioning, mental toughness and match play. They will be encouraged to play in USTA tournaments also. An emphasis will be placed on stroke production, power, intensity, focus, and match play skills. We prepare players to move up to the next level on a team or in the rankings.

TYPICAL DAY

9:00 - 9:20 Orientation/Stretching/Warm-Up
9:20 - 10:40 Drilling & Instruction
10:40 - 12:00 Field Play & Fitness
12:00 - 1:00 Lunch / Tournament Matches
1:00 - 2:00 Tennis Games
2:00 - 3:30 Point Play / Swimming
3:30 - 4:00 Snack / Davis Cup
4:00 Departure

Camp Director- Jacques DuToit
Jacques is returning for his fifth summer as Director. He played collegiate tennis at Oklahoma State University and was a traveling member of the South Africa Davis Cup team 1996-2000. Jacques is the Director of Tennis at the Armonk Tennis Club, where he teaches year-round.
